PerformID takes the event result, gives the athlete a claim page, then opens a workspace, Passport patch and next-step view they can return to.
Athletes can leave an event with a score screenshot or a leaderboard row but no persistent record. They may not know what improved, what to share, or what would move them toward the next target.
The hub turns verified event data into an athlete-facing record that is useful without overwhelming the athlete with controls.
